Restaurants/Bars

In the restaurant and bar scene, the use of audio/visual elements is critical in creating an overall experience that customers enjoy and remember. The combination of music and TV is essential to set the tone, create a welcoming ambiance, and establish an atmosphere that enhances customer satisfaction and loyalty.

BARS

The strategic use of audio, such as music, sound effects, and even spoken words, can influence the mood of the customers and make them feel more relaxed or energized. The right visual elements, such as lighting, video projections, and even art installations, can set the tone for the night and create a memorable experience for the customers. Together, audio and visual elements can create an immersive environment that captures the attention of the customers and keeps them engaged.

Restaurants

Audio/Visual (AV) elements have become increasingly important in the restaurant industry as they play a crucial role in enhancing the overall dining experience. AV technology has transformed the way restaurants communicate and engage with their customers. High-quality sound systems, video screens, and lighting can create a dynamic and immersive atmosphere that stimulates the senses, adds an extra layer of entertainment, and creates a memorable experience for diners.

​

AV technology is also used to showcase menu items, specials, and promotions, which can help increase sales and customer engagement. Video screens can display mouth-watering images of the dishes, while audio can provide a description of the food and drinks, or even play music that complements the cuisine. Additionally, AV technology can provide practical benefits such as improving communication between staff and customers, enabling remote ordering and payment, and reducing wait times.
